VELASCO HURTADO, Carlos and CRUZ PRIETO, José. Removal of Sn and Sb from a concentrated sulfur complex Ag-Pb-Zn. Rev. Met. UTO [online]. 2016, n.39, pp. 19-25. ISSN 2078-5593.
Abstract The paper shows the results of digestion of a concentrated complex of Ag-Pb-Zn with mixtures of Na2S and NaOH having in its mineralogy as main minerals: cylindrite and "frankeita", in order to solubilize the Sn and Sb to recover these metals of the solution. It has been studied the effect of the temperature, molar rate between , sodium sulfide concentration and digestion time on the degree of extraction of these metals. Recoveries of 95% of antimony and 80% of tin were obtained with digestion times of 20 minutes, at a process temperature of 80 X process and within a molar rate Na2S/Na2Sstoichiometric of 2.
Keywords : Alkaline digestion; franckeita; cylindrite; antimony removal; tin removal.
